那些陌生又熟悉的前端面试题
JavaScript 语言是一门弱类型语言,存在许多类型错误,因此 ES6 引入了严格模式概念。如果不加 ‘use strict’ 常规模式下就是属于非严格模式。严格模式 在 js 文件顶部添加 ‘use strict’ 就属于严格模式,严格模式也可以指定在函数内部。
Vue3 前端面试题解答 Vue3 中响应式 API 的使用与区别问题:请简述 Vue3 中 ref(), shallowRef(), triggerRef(), toRef(), toRefs(), reactive(), shallowReactive() 的使用场景及区别。答案:ref():用于创建顶级响应式对象,可以在模板中直接使用而无需添加 .value。
JavaScript如何实现继承?举例说明。JavaScript通过prototype属性实现继承。例如,子类继承父类,可通过Child.prototype = new Parent()实现。子类构造函数内执行父类构造函数,通过Parent.apply(this, arguments)传递子类作用域和参数,从而继承父类构造函数。
答案:包括选择器增强(如属性选择器、伪类选择器)、动画(如@keyframes、animation)、过渡(transition)、媒体查询(@media)、弹性盒布局(Flexbox)、网格布局(Grid)等。ES6面试题 说说var、let、const之间的区别 答案: var:函数作用域或全局作用域,存在变量提升(Hoisting),可以重复声明。
请教一道公务员考试逻辑判断题
1、答案A太绝对了,可以至少都不参加或都参加,因此不正确。
2、D.小张会被挑选上,而小王不会 国家公务员行测逻辑判断试题答案:答案: B 解析:答案: B 解析:答案: D 解析:“拥有平板电脑人数最多”和“计算机成绩最好”在上述班级中是两个同时并存的现象。
3、因此,“只有…才…”的逻辑结构是后推前,即从结果推导出条件。这种逻辑关系在公务员考试的逻辑判断题中经常出现,需要我们正确理解和应用。
4、国家公务员考试逻辑判断题答案 答案: B 解析: 题干中论证的条件为某国南部地区火车事故多,结论为北部地区坐火车安全。
11个编程学习及刷题网站!
1、牛客网 简介:牛客网是一个互联网求职学习交流社区,适合求职面试的人。可以在上面找到大厂的面试真题,还可以做专项练习、模拟笔试和AI模拟面试。特点:求职面试必备,题目真实,模拟面试效果好。以下是部分网站的图片展示:希望这些推荐能够帮助大家找到适合自己的编程学习平台和资源,提升学习效率,实现编程技能的提升。
2、以下是11个编程学习及刷题网站的推荐:课程学习平台 菜鸟教程 :适合新手入门,提供Python、JavaScript、C++等多门编程语言的详尽文档和丰富案例。W3Schools:一站式学习平台,涵盖从HTML、CSS到高级JS、PHP等的全面教程,JavaScript教程尤其详细全面。
3、LeetCode 简介:专为面试而生的刷题网站,有助于提升编程思维和算法能力。链接:http://leetcode.cn 图片:XDA论坛 简介:Android开源开发者论坛,讨论和开发Android、Windows phone等手机系统,提供技术支持。
4、最受欢迎的学习编程的网站之一就是CodeAcademy啦。事实上,已经有超过2400万人通过这个教育公司的迷人经验学习过如何编程,在CodeAcademy,通过上课你可以深入了解到从HTML&CSS、JavaScript、jQuery、PHP、Python到Ruby的所有东西。
程序员常用的刷题网站
简介:LeetCode是一个专注于算法题的刷题网站,非常适合程序员求职准备。很多大厂在面试时都会考察算法,通过在这里刷题,可以显著提升你的算法水平。无论是求职还是平时工作,掌握扎实的算法基础都是非常有用的。
以下是几个程序员常用的刷题网站: LeetCode 网址:https://leetcode-cn.com/简介:LeetCode是程序员非常熟悉的刷题网站,很多优秀的程序员都在此网站上刷题,同时也有一些面试官会从上面挑选面试题目。
特点:GeeksforGeeks是一个在线刷题网站,提供了大量的算法题,并且每道题都附有优质的解这些解答不仅给出了正确的代码,还解释了代码背后的逻辑和思路。适用人群:适合有一定编程基础的程序员,希望通过刷题来提升自己的算法理解和编程能力。
django会问哪些面试题(django面试题总结)
1、这是哪儿的django面试题目或者笔试题目吧,请查看django开发手册。 queryset是查询集,就是传到服务器上的url里面的查询内容。Django会对查询返回的结果集QuerySet进行缓存,这是为了提高查询效率。
2、问题4:Django框架遵循MVC设计,并且有一个专有名词:MVTMVT各部分的功能:M全拼为Model,与MVC中的M功能相同,负责和数据库交互,进行数据处理。V全拼为View,与MVC中的C功能相同,接收请求,进行业务处理,返回应T全拼为Template,与MVC中的V功能相同,负责封装构造要返回的html。
3、Django请求对象的创建时间。1 Django重定向的实现及使用的状态码。1 XSS攻击的简介。1 Django中CSRF的实现机制。1 使用AJAX发送POST请求时,携带CSRF token的常用方法。1 Django runserver与uWSGI的区别。1 Cookie与Session的区别。1 Django ORM中QuerySet对象的所有方法。
4、需要安装redispy库,并在Django设置中配置Redis作为缓存后端。模板中filter与simple_tag的区别:filter用于接收变量并返回变量,通常用于字符串处理;simple_tag可以接收任意数量的参数,并返回任意类型的结果。
5、本文是Django经典面试问题与答案系列的中篇内容,旨在为学习和工作提供帮助。以下是具体问题及答案:1 请简述Django的CSRF防御机制。Django的CSRF保护机制通过django.middleware.csrf.CsrfViewMiddleware中间件实现,其核心流程涉及csrftoken和csrfmiddlewaretoken的生成与验证。